One other point I think might help also.
I notice myself doing it every once in a while, so I'm sure that there are others that do it too. Casting a vote on a top-level node (the node that everyone replies to) should have only maybe half the chance of receiving that +1 XP. Why do I propose this? Because any user that simply votes on the main nodes doesn't really need to do any work to receive XP. So, voting on a top-level node should have half the odds of receiving +1 XP, while votes used on replies have the same odds they have now. This way, users will be motivated to look *into* the nodes at the replies, and maybe even learn something along the way :) In reply to RE: Proposed XP System Changes
